Alibaba-backed Asian group Daraz cuts workforce 11%

Alibaba-backed Asian group Daraz cuts workforce 11%

ALIBABA-OWNED e-commerce platform Daraz Group is reducing its workforce in the Indian subcontinent by 11 per cent due to the ‘current market reality’, chief executive officer Bjarke Mikkelsen said, suggesting job losses that could affect about 300 people.
